Output e8a33597c487330b7dec5a0c81a0933caf6496445da11afcb0d71d263099c21a:1

value
1150102560
script pubkey
OP_0 OP_PUSHBYTES_20 3ed50a0e7d2deb920901790ea16a896953a8cdc0
address
bc1q8m2s5rna9h4eyzgp0y82z65fd9f63nwq3knlyk
transaction
e8a33597c487330b7dec5a0c81a0933caf6496445da11afcb0d71d263099c21a
confirmations
336010
spent
true